CoorsTek to Present White Paper on Cultivating Employee Involvement at Boston AME Conference


CoorsTek to present latest developments in transforming employees into sustainable change agents for continuous-improvement manufacturing efforts.

Golden, Colorado, August 26, 2005 - CoorsTek, Inc., a large technical ceramics supplier and manufacturer of critical components and integrated assemblies for high-technology markets, today announced their white paper on Cultivating Employee Involvement to be presented at the AME (Association for Manufacturing Excellence) Annual Conference in Boston, October 31 - November 4, 2005.

Co-authored by CoorsTek manufacturing experts Rob Spurrier and Eric Braaton, the presentation illustrates key concepts associated with successful and sustainable employee-initiated lean and best-practice manufacturing programs.

"Because employee involvement is a key factor in sustainability, we have adopted a program involving associates at all levels of training, participation, and leadership," states Rob Spurrier, co-author of the presentation and plant manager for one of the largest CoorsTek facilities. "Engaging staff in all phases of the business from value-stream mapping to layout for flow to our best-solution program, CoorsTek benefits not only from the continuous improvement itself, but fosters employee buy in as well," continues Spurrier.

Spurrier and Braaton identify tools designed to optimize continuous improvement programs and foster an engaged and enthusiastic workforce. Cultivating Employee Involvement is one of several programs that comprise the CoorsTek OpXSM Operational Excellence program - a carefully blended hybrid of several best-practice manufacturing techniques including six sigma, lean manufacturing, DMAIC (define, measure, analyze, improve, control), Kaisen, and other proven systems.

More about CoorsTek...
CoorsTek is the largest technical ceramics manufacturer in North America and has facilities in Europe and Asia. CoorsTek supplies critical components and assemblies for medical, automotive, semiconductor, aerospace, electronic, power generation, telecommunication, and other high-technology applications. Utilizing advanced material technologies, the company's engineered solutions enable its customers' products to overcome technological barriers and improve performance.
